NHP-GCP Board of Ed Notebook: April 8

Other news from the April 8 board of education meeting.

The New Hyde Park-Garden City Park Board of Education held a meeting on Monday, April 8. Here are some of the things you may have missed.

Grants

  • The board accepted a donation in the amount of $2,300 from the New Hyde Park Road School PTA Sixth Grade Committee for the balance of the class trip aboard the Marco Polo Cruise.
  • A $1,050 grant was accepted from the Hillside Grade School PTA for the Petra Puppets Program.
  • A $190 grant was accepted from the New Hyde Park Road School PTA for Arithmetickles – Art Echo Children’s Theatre Centre.
  • A grant of $32 was accepted from the New Hyde Park Road School PTA for a Sky Dome Planetarium Assembly.
  • The amount of $763 was transferred from a previous donation for Grand Falloons Assembly s the entire assembly was paid through BOCES.
Contracts
  • The board approved a field trip contract for the Garden City Park School with the Waterfront Center in Oyster Bay.
  • A cultural arts program contract for the Hillside Grade School was approved with Petra Puppets. A contract for ATDW Dance Class was approved with UPK Harbor Child Care.
  • A letter of engagement was approved with R.S. Abrams & Co. to be the external auditors for the district for the 2013-14 school year.
Personnel
  • Director of pupil personnel services Dr. Raymond Brodeur will retire are of June 30, 2013.
  • Special education classroom aide Mary Calia will retire as of April 2, 2013.
  • The board appointed Luchina Fabrizi as a substitute door monitor as of April 9. The board appointed Jyoti-Nina Romani as a substitute classroom aide as of April 9.
Policies
  • The following district policies were adopted after their second readings: Appointments and Designations by the Board of Education, Appointment and Duties of the Claims Auditor, Duties of the School Physician/Nurse Practitioner, Regular Board Meetings, Use of School Facilities, Materials and Equipment, Public Access to Records, Code of Conduct on School Property, Non Discrimination and Anti-Harassment in the School District, Sexual Harassment of District Personnel.
  • First readings of were held on the following district policies: Purchasing; Accounting of Fixed Assets; Facilities: Inspection, Operation and Maintenance; Pest Management and Pesticide Use; Energy Conservation and Recycling in the Schools; Safety and Security; Fire Drills, Bomb Threats and Bus Emergency Drills; School Bus Safety Program.
Other Board News
  • The board received a grievance regarding credit reclassification from the New Hyde Park Teachers Association. The decision was declined.
  • The VFW requested use of the Manor Oaks and Hillside Grade School bands to participate in the Memorial Day Parade on Saturday, May 25 at 10 a.m.
  • The board approved the property tax report card for the 2013-14 school budget as well as a tax anticipation note (TAN) in the amount not to exceed $5 million.
The next meeting of the New Hyde Park-Garden City Park Board of Education is Monday, May 20 at 8 p.m. at Manor Oaks.
